Gravity cask at Pigs Ear '23, day two, 29/11/23. Almost clear golden blonde with an off white head. Nose is earthy, fusty, hedgerow, stewed fruits. Taste comprises biscuit, herb, straw, grains, dull fruit esters, toffee. Medium bodied, soft carbonation, semi drying close. Decent flavoursome bitter.

Gravity cask at One Inn The Wood, Petts Wood on 29th September 2023. Clear amber with shallow whitish foam and full lacing. Aroma of pungent resins. Complex tangy fruits in-mouth and an explosion of savoury nuttiness - peanut. Malts and rich, ripe fruits dominate the finish, and a little bitterness develops on the upper rear mouth. Light bodied with a smooth mouthfeel.

3.9% Cask gravity at Firkin Ale House Folkestone, clear gold lasting thin white head. yes clearly still a Goachers beer a bit like the Light. Hoppier than most Goachers beers. Good hoppy bitter finish. Nice enough.
